Effects of Methylsulfonylmethane and Epidermal Growth Factor Receptor-Tyrosine Kinase Inhibitor on Cell Proliferation, Cell Cycle and Anti-Inflammatory Effect in Chicken Intestinal Epithelial Cells with Lipopolysaccharide Challenge

چکیده

Background: Intestinal epithelial injury stress is one of the most common stresses in contemporary poultry breeding. This study aims to evaluate protective effects Methylsulfonylmethane (MSM) and epidermal growth factor receptor-tyrosine kinase inhibitor (EGFR-TKI, erlotinib) on induced by lipopolysaccharides (LPS) chicken intestinal cells (IECs).
